Weather in Southern France

The South of France boasts a Mediterranean climate with over 300 days of sunshine annually, creating the perfect setting for outdoor activities and relaxation. This region is renowned for its vibrant culture, charming villages, and delicious cuisine. From the lavender fields of Provence to the sparkling waters of the French Riviera, the South of France is a paradise for nature lovers. With its rich history, stunning architecture, and picturesque landscapes, it's no wonder why this area is a popular destination for real estate investment.
